University of Guam’s REEF Internship Boosts Sustainability

The University of Guam just dropped a game-changer for students in all fields: the new REEF Internship program. If you thought sustainability was just about whipping up eco-friendly projects in science labs, think again! This initiative from the Center for Island Sustainability and Sea Grant is leveling up opportunities for everyone—whether you’re studying psychology, engineering, or business.

The Research Education and Extension Fellowship (REEF) mixes disciplines to tackle sustainability. UOG’s Director Dr. Austin Shelton emphasizes that we all have a role to play in sustainable development, not just those with science degrees. This isn’t just an academic exercise; it’s about real-world impacts. The program is designed to give you hands-on experience, with mentorship from industry pros who are seriously passionate about making Guam a greener place.

These fellows will dive into a 20-week paid fellowship, working closely with mentors on projects involving conservation, waste management, and other pressing sustainability issues facing the region. It’s a perfect blend of gaining experience and contributing to community-focused solutions.

UOG Provost Dr. Sharleen Santos-Bamba is all about this investment in young talent, hoping it will inspire the next generation.
